IFTO represents India at 6th UNWTO World Forum

The World Tourism Organization (UNWTO), VISITFLANDERS, Bruges city and Basque Culinary Center (BCC) hosted the 6th UNWTO World Forum on Gastronomy Tourism from 31st Oct to 2 Nov 2021 in Bruges, Belgium.

The forum provides a global platform for experts in travel, hospitality and culinary fields from various countries to share ideas and present solutions to issues related to the Food travel industry. The theme for this year’s meet was ‘Gastronomy Tourism: Promoting Rural Tourism and Regional Development’ and it focused on economic development of communities and revival of tourism with a focus on culinary tourism.
India was represented by Chef Rajeev Goyal, president of the India Food Tourism Organisation (IFTO). He spoke about the contribution of gastronomy, preservation of local culinary knowledge and sustainable tourism to the revival of the tourism industry and economic and social development of local communities and even the people not directly involved in the tourism industry.

Other speakers included Chef Dieuveil Malonga, Founder of Chefs in Africa, Teresa Agovino, from Faroo, Vee Bougani from Sustainable Food Movement, Julia Goeschelbauer from Culinary Network Austria and a few more subject matter experts over the course of three days.

The closing event took place at Brewery De Halve Maan, a family brewery in Bruges.
